What is the relationship between glucose and glycogen

Respuesta :

kmatras1
kmatras1 kmatras1
  • 20-02-2017
Glucose is a form of sugar that our bodies can digest. Glycogen is simply glucose that has been stored. So, once glucose has been digested and entered the blood, it changes into glycogen so that we can store it for future use.
